传感器怎样与单片机实现连接和控制? 5

我做一个单片机小车。但是不知道怎样将传感器与单片机相连。请知道的高手多多指教!!谢谢!我是指硬件相连的方式。如果可以的话最好给出一个连接原理图和相应的C程序。谢谢。... 我做一个单片机小车。但是不知道怎样将传感器与单片机相连。请知道的高手多多指教!!谢谢!
我是指硬件相连的方式。如果可以的话最好给出一个连接原理图和相应的C程序。谢谢。
展开
 我来答
王律师案件普法

2019-09-18 · TA获得超过35.9万个赞
知道大有可为答主
回答量:374
采纳率:89%
帮助的人:34.2万
展开全部

灰度传感器有三条线,VCC,GND,和信号线,他信号线输出的是模拟电压,普通的51只能通过电压比较器LM339来辨别两种不同的颜色,但是如果用增强的51就可以用他自带的AD来测。

只需要吧信号线接到增强的51的有AD功能的端口,启动AD来读他的电压就能辨别不同的颜色了。

有各种传感器它们的连接方法不同的,有的信号输出大可以直接连单片机,如LM35可以直接连到单片机的AD转换口。

有的信号小要进行放大后才能到单片机的AD转换口。如果到单片机没有AD转换口,那么还要经过AD转换才能到单片机。当然传感器自己也有各种连接电路。

扩展资料:

AM2301电容式温湿度传感器+MQ2气体传感器+GP2Y1010AU0F灰尘传感器+HC-SR501人体红外感应模块+光敏电阻传感器模块。

其中人体红外感应模块(开关量)输出端可以直接连接到开发板任何IO端。

其他都是模拟量,如果输出不是数字量,要经过AD转换,不能直接连到单片机开发板上。

参考资料来源:百度百科 ——单片机

参考资料来源:百度百科——传感器(检测装置)

hrbfmc
2010-12-02 · TA获得超过138个赞
知道答主
回答量:71
采纳率:100%
帮助的人:43.9万
展开全部
传感器和单片机的连接方式不固定,这要看传感器了,有的IIC总线的,这种传感器只要和单片机任一输入输出口的任两根线相连即可,还有TTL串口的,只要和单片机的TX和RX相连即可。具体的你得看传感器什么样,看是数字传感器还是模拟传感器,模拟传感器还要加AD转换电路。前面两种我说的是数字的
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
我是一值鱼
2010-12-02 · TA获得超过632个赞
知道小有建树答主
回答量:363
采纳率:0%
帮助的人:278万
展开全部
不同的传感器有不同的连接方式,因此要彻底阅读传感器的PDF资料,然后再连接,有各种可能的,比如连AD,测电平时间,测频率,读数据,等等,根本方法还是仔细阅读PDF资料,并且即使测量同一量的传感器,其测量范围,读出数值也不一定一样
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
小灰马mxh
高粉答主

推荐于2017-09-16 · 醉心答题,欢迎关注
知道大有可为答主
回答量:6527
采纳率:97%
帮助的人:396万
展开全部
灰度传感器有三条线,VCC,GND,和信号线,他信号线输出的是模拟电压,普通的51只能通过电压比较器LM339来辨别两种不同的颜色,但是如果用增强的51就可以用他自带的AD来测。只需要吧信号线接到增强的51的有AD功能的端口,启动AD来读他的电压就能辨别不同的颜色了。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
微雨天涯dr7d7
2010-12-02 · TA获得超过186个赞
知道小有建树答主
回答量:274
采纳率:0%
帮助的人:206万
展开全部
把传感器的检测信号用比较器(如LM393等)转为高低电平再输入单片机I/O口,软件设计读取I/O口就行啦
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(4)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式